Museum of the Mountain West
The Museum of the Mountain West provides a fascinating glimpse into the pioneer and ranching history of the region, located a brief drive from the aquatic center. This unique museum is housed in former ranch buildings and features extensive collections of artifacts, tools, and period furnishings that vividly recreate life in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Visitors can explore authentic homesteads and gain a deep appreciation for the resilience and ingenuity of early settlers. It offers an educational and engaging experience for all ages, providing historical context to the Montrose area.

Enstrom Candies
Enstrom Candies is a renowned local institution famous for its delectable toffee and other handcrafted chocolates. While primarily a confectionery shop, they also offer a selection of ice cream and other treats, making it a sweet destination for a post-activity indulgence. It’s a charming spot to pick up a locally made souvenir or simply enjoy a sweet moment. The quality and craftsmanship of their products have made them a beloved part of the Montrose community and a delightful stop for visitors.

Weather & Seasons at Montrose Aquatic Center
- Winter: Winter in Montrose brings cold temperatures, often hovering near or below freezing, with regular snowfall. Visitors should pack warm layers, including heavy coats, hats, gloves, and insulated footwear. While the aquatic center provides a warm indoor escape, travel to and from the venue requires attention to road conditions, which can be slick or temporarily impacted by snow. Plan for potential delays and ensure your vehicle is equipped for winter driving.
- Spring & early summer: As spring transitions into early summer, Montrose enjoys mild to pleasant weather, with daytime temperatures gradually warming into the 50s and 60s Fahrenheit. It's an excellent time for outdoor exploration, but pack layers as evenings can still be cool. Light jackets or sweaters are advisable. The weather is generally conducive to travel and accessing the aquatic center without significant disruption, though occasional spring showers are possible.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er, from July through August, is typically warm to hot, with average daytime temperatures in the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Sunscreen, hats, and light, breathable clothing are essential for comfort. While ideal for swimming and water sports, outdoor activities might require early morning or late afternoon timing to avoid the peak heat. Hydration is crucial, and visitors should be mindful of the sun's intensity.
- Fall season: Fall brings crisp, cool air to Montrose, with temperatures starting in the 50s and steadily dropping as the season progresses. The landscape becomes vibrant with autumn colors, offering beautiful scenery. Pack layers, including sweaters and light jackets, as temperatures can fluctuate. The weather is generally pleasant for travel and activities, though late fall can see the first snows, signaling the transition back to winter conditions.
